Questions & Answers about Deras granne är mycket gammal.
Does deras change depending on whether granne is an en-word, ett-word, or plural?
No, it doesn't! Unlike min (my) and din (your), third-person possessive pronouns like deras (their), hans (his), and hennes (her) never change their form to match the noun. You will always use deras regardless of the noun's gender or number.
Why do we use the indefinite form granne instead of the definite form grannen? Aren't we talking about a specific neighbor?
In Swedish, whenever you use a possessive pronoun like deras (their), min (my), or hans (his), the noun that follows must always be in the indefinite form. So it is deras granne, never deras grannen.
I learned that mycket means "much" or "a lot". Can it also mean "very"?
Yes! When mycket is used to describe a quantity of a noun, it means "much" or "a lot". But when you put it directly in front of an adjective like gammal (old) or bra (good), it acts as an intensifier and translates to "very".
